It was for me with various routers (WRT54G, Motorola 54G, UFO Airport Extreme). With both Airport Extreme N or D-Link DIR-655 I get nearly 100Mb at distances of about 75'. With 40MHz channels I get up to 2X that depending on the file time and what device I'm copying from. Of course I never get anywhere near the advertised 270Mb but I get 3-5X the speeds I ever saw from 11g.

802.11n would be overkill if it were really expensive (like 802.11a is/was), but with routers getting cheaper, and a lot of newer notebooks including it, I personally think it's worth it. Even when I bring my notebook back to my desk, I don't bother to plug into my network to do TM backups or transfer large files.

I see better than 90Mb on 802.11n and that is with only 20MHz channels (not bad for a theo max of 130Mb). I also see much farther range than I ever did with 802.11g. With 802.11g I was lucky to see 35Mb and on the other side of the house I was lucky to get more than 2Mb.
